Have to see it to believe it

I'm a troper who's in LOVE with bad movies. So Bad It's Good is an absolute goldmine to me. And once upon a time, I found out about this little movie, Foodfight. It was released years after the planned date, it was poorly animated, and it starred Charlie Sheen! It was a dream come true, and eventually I got the rare chance to view the amazing trainwreck of a movie.

To sum up the plot, take a cup full of Casablanca, add a pinch of Wreck-It Ralph, and cool until you get something akin to Thanksgiving leftovers. From the Indiana Jones-esque hero to the cat girl love interest who is contractually obligated to smile to the spasming villain figure, this movie will delight the mental taste buds of anyone who loves bad movies. Special mention goes to Vlad Chocul, who is certainly not Count Chocula at all and is also completely unambiguously homosexual.

The main attraction is the animation, which is flawed beyond belief. A character in Foodfight is either mostly idle or static, or they're having a seizure while hooking themselves up to an array of car batteries. Almost everything that explodes will become massive blobs, which is hilarious when there's a big climatic scene with lots of exploding food being tossed around.

All in all, Foodfight is too horrible to go over everything in one review, especially when it's been a while since my viewing, but if you love bad movies, this thing is a delightful must-see movie. It's so horrible that I can't help but say to watch it, just to experience the ridiculousness.
